计算机网络(一)

>数据链路层(data link

           两种方式:

                   1)点对点:协议:ppp                   

                   2)广播信道:一对多------专用的共享信道协议

 

链路(link) 从一个节点到相邻节点的一段物理线路,而中间没有其他的交换节点。

数据链路(data link): 实现通信协议的硬件和软件+链路-----------网络适配器

规程(procedure:早期的数据通信协议。

帧:PDU(协议数据单元) belong to data link

三个问题:1)封装成帧

              2) 透明传输

  3)差错检测-----------CRC(无差错接收,并非可靠传输,无比特差错)

    PPP:要求:简单,封装成帧,透明,支持多种网络层协议,运行在多种类型的链路上,差错检测,检测连接状态,最大传送单元(数据部分),网络层地址协商,数据压缩协议。

        特点:不可靠传输协议,全双工链路(Only) 

        字段意义

  

F:7E

A:FF

C03

Protocol 2B

信息部分<1500

CRCFCS 2Bw

F7E

 

   广播信道(局域网)

     类型:星形网----------集线器和双绞线的大量使用

           环形网----------令牌环形

           总线网----------CSMA/CD 演变成星形

           树形网

           通信:Mancherster 编码  

                 CSMA/CD(载波监听多点接入/碰撞检测)

                 争用期:2t ---------------最短帧长64B,小于64的都是冲突引起  的无效帧。

                 截断二进制指数退避算法

                 集线器:星形网的中心,可靠性非常高。使用集线器的局域网物 理上虽然是星形网,但是逻辑上仍然是总线网,各站共 享逻辑上的总线,各占中的适配器使用仍然是 CSMA/CD协议,同一时刻只允许一个站点发送数据, 工作在物理层。

                 MAC帧格式:

目的地址 6B

源地址 6B

类型 2B

数据 461500 IP数据报)

FCS 4B

                  扩充:

                         物理层,数据链路层

                          1)物理层:集线器---------一个碰撞域,不同的以太网技术则  不可 互联,集线器只是一个多接口的转发器,无缓存。

                          2)数据链路层:网桥-----MAC帧和接口的转发表------提高了可靠性,过滤通信量增大吞吐量,隔离碰撞域,可互联不同物理层不同的MAC层不同的数据率。增加时延,无流量控制功能,用户多时易于产生广播风暴,网桥在转发帧时不改变源地址---------透明网桥:即插即用,自学习,生成树算法(避免兜圈子)-----------多接口网桥:以太网交换机,可以很方便的实现虚拟局域网(VLAN)的功能。4BVLAN标记,抑制了广播风暴的发生,且以太网的最大长度为1500+18+4 1522B

目的地址 

源地址 

VLAN tag

类型 2B

数据 461500 IP数据报)

FCS 4B

 

网络层

      设计思路:只向上层提供简单灵活的无连接的尽最大努力交付的数据报服务。

  不进行编号,不建立连接,不提供服务质量的承诺,不按序到达终端。

  虚电路:可靠通信由网络保证,必须有连接,每个分组使用短的虚电路号,分 组按同一路由转发,按序到达,差错处理可以有网络负责也可以由主 机负责

  IP协议:IP,ARP,RARP,ICMP,IGMP配套使用,解决互连异构的网络,使得主 机通信时就像是在一个单个的网络上。

            IP数据报的格式:

首部长度:4B×N515

总长度:首部加上数据 16bit5761500

标识:相同的标识是一个数据报,并非是序号,IP无连接没有序号。

片偏移:数据部分,不包括首部。N×8B 分片后该片的数据部分的长度

首部校验和:数据报的首部,16位进位相加,取反,得到结果。

  IP地址:分类IP地址:ABC单播,D组播,E保留

                    子网的划分---------子网号为全01有时也可以使用

    构成超网----主机号为全01有时也可以使用了---地址聚合  

            IP多播(multicast以前曾经以为组播):服务器仅需发送一次多播既可以满足很多的主机的视频请求。路由器必须增加能够识别出多播数据报的软件,分组需使用多播IP地址即DIP地址。当服务器发送多播数据报时,在目的地址中写入多播组的标识符. 注意:对于多播数据不产生ICMP差错报文,PING后接多播地址将永远也收不到回应。

            ARP协议:

  ARP请求包(广播):ARP缓存地址项目生存时间:10~20分钟。

  ARP应答包(单播):

              RARP协议(DHCP已经包含了RARP的功能)

              ICMP网际控制报文协议:ICMP差错报告报文,ICMP询问报文。

                    终点不可达                                    

                                   源点抑制

时间超过                                          

                    参数问题                             

                    改变路由        

             IGMP:网际组管理协议---------让连接在本地局域网的路由器知道本地是否有主机加入或者退出了某个多播组。

             多播路由器协议-----不仅仅根据多播数据报中的目的地址,而且要考虑从什么地方来到什么地方去。

         路由器

             A. 路由选择协议

                  1)IGP 自治系统内部使用的路由选择协议,RIPOSPF

RIP:路由信息协议.----------距离向量算法------UDP协议

        与哪些路由交换----------------相邻

        交换什么信息--------------自己的路由表

        什么时候交换--------------定期交换或者拓扑变化

        特点:简单开销小,好消息传的快,但是坏消息传的慢。

OSPF:开放最短路径优先-----链路状态协议(link state protocol)  -------------IP协议

链路发生变化时采用洪泛发与所有的路由交换自己相邻的路由信息。最终可以建   成一个链路状态数据库,即全网的拓 扑结构图。 

特点:更新过程收敛的快,数据报短,负载平衡。

五种分组类型:问候------------10秒交换一次,40秒未收   到不可达

  数据库描述

  链路状态请求

                                      链路状态更新

  两路状态确认。

                  2)EGP: BGP-4

                         BGP--------外部网关协议

             B. 路由器的构成

                  分成两部分,路由选择部分和分组转发部分。路由选择部分核心构件是   路由选择处理机,根据路由选择协议构造出路由表;分组转发部分有交   换结构,一组输入端口和一组输出端口,其中的交换结构作用就是根据   路由表来选择合适的端口转发分组。输入端口输出端口包含三个处理模   块物理层进行比特的接收或者传送,数据链路层进行接受或者传送分   组的帧,最后还有网络层处理模块进行查表和转发。网络层模块中还有   一个缓冲区用于暂存未发送的分组 

  两个解决IP地址紧缺的协议VPN(虚拟专用网)和NAT(网络地址转换)

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值